Judges Refute Claims of Jan. 6 Rioters as 'Political Prisoners'

TL;DR Summary
Judges overseeing the Capitol riot cases are pushing back against efforts to portray the rioters as political prisoners or heroes, warning that such rhetoric poses a serious threat to the nation. Despite some defendants embracing this narrative and hoping for a Trump victory to secure their release, judges from both political parties have consistently condemned the riot as an attack on democracy and admonished defendants for not showing true remorse. The judges have sentenced many rioters to prison terms, emphasizing that the actions of January 6 cannot be repeated without serious repercussions.
